From d2392435048a5d75f2d10b4d88a2c8ac29a254f1 Mon Sep 17 00:00:00 2001
From: king <18310653075@163.com>
Date: 星期三, 18 六月 2025 22:34:05 +0800
Subject: [PATCH] 2025-06-18

---
 src/mob/components/navbar/normal-navbar/index.scss |  148 ++++++++++++++++++++-----------------------------
 1 files changed, 60 insertions(+), 88 deletions(-)

diff --git a/src/mob/components/navbar/normal-navbar/index.scss b/src/mob/components/navbar/normal-navbar/index.scss
index 67d1e9f..0a0851d 100644
--- a/src/mob/components/navbar/normal-navbar/index.scss
+++ b/src/mob/components/navbar/normal-navbar/index.scss
@@ -1,5 +1,5 @@
 .normal-navbar-edit-box {
-  position: fixed;
+  position: absolute;
   bottom: 0px;
   left: 0px;
   width: 100%;
@@ -8,40 +8,42 @@
   background-position: center center;
   background-repeat: no-repeat;
   background-size: cover;
-  min-height: 50px;
+  min-height: 30px;
   z-index: 3;
   
   .menu {
-    display: block;
+    height: 100%;
+    display: flex;
     font-size: inherit;
     color: inherit;
-    .ant-menu {
-      background: transparent;
-      line-height: inherit;
-      font-size: inherit;
-      color: inherit;
-      border: 0;
-      .ant-menu-item:hover, .ant-menu-item-active {
-        color: unset;
+    .am-tab-bar-tab {
+      position: relative;
+      text-align: center;
+      flex: 1;
+      cursor: pointer;
+      .anticon {
+        font-size: 150%;
       }
-      .ant-menu-item span {
-        display: inline-block;
+      .am-tab-bar-tab-title:first-child {
+        font-size: 14px;
+        line-height: 40px;
+      }
+      .am-badge-text {
+        position: absolute;
+        top: -2px;
+        height: 8px;
+        width: 8px;
+        border-radius: 100%;
+        background: #ff5b05;
+        z-index: 1;
+      }
+      p {
+        margin-bottom: 0;
       }
     }
-    .ant-menu-horizontal > .ant-menu-item:hover, .ant-menu-horizontal > .ant-menu-item-active, .ant-menu-horizontal > .ant-menu-item-open, .ant-menu-horizontal > .ant-menu-item-selected {
-      color: unset;
-    }
+    
   }
-  .card-control {
-    position: absolute;
-    top: 0px;
-    left: 0px;
-    .anticon-tool {
-      right: auto;
-      left: 1px;
-      padding: 1px;
-    }
-  }
+
   .anticon-tool {
     position: absolute;
     z-index: 2;
@@ -52,53 +54,42 @@
     padding: 5px;
     background: rgba(255, 255, 255, 0.55);
   }
+}
 
-  .card-item {
-    overflow: hidden;
+.normal-navbar-edit-box:not(.class1) {
+  .menu .am-tab-bar-tab.tab-zoomIn {
+    .am-tab-bar-tab-icon {
+      padding: 10px;
+      display: inline-block;
+      background: #1890ff;
+      color: #ffffff;
+      border-radius: 40px;
+      width: 42px;
+      height: 42px;
+      font-size: 15px;
+      transform: translate(0px, -25px);
+    }
+    .am-tab-bar-tab-title {
+      font-size: 1.2em;
+      color: #1890ff;
+      transform: translate(0px, -22px);
+    }
+  }
+}
+.normal-navbar-edit-box.class1 {
+  background-color: #1890ff!important;
+  border-top-left-radius: 40px;
+  border-top-right-radius: 40px;
+  .am-tab-bar-tab-icon {
+    color: #ffffff;
     position: relative;
-    background-color: #ffffff;
-    background-position: center center;
-    background-repeat: no-repeat;
-    background-size: cover;
-    min-height: 20px;
+    top: 5px;
   }
-  
-  .card-item:hover {
-    box-shadow: 0px 0px 2px #1890ff;
+  .menu .am-tab-bar-tab .anticon {
+    font-size: 20px;
   }
-
-  .model-menu-card-cell-list .card-detail-row > .anticon-plus {
-    position: absolute;
-    right: -30px;
-    font-size: 16px;
-  }
-  .model-menu-action-list {
-    line-height: 40px;
-    .ant-row > .anticon-plus {
-      position: absolute;
-      right: -30px;
-      font-size: 16px;
-    }
-  }
-  .card-add-button {
-    text-align: right;
-    clear: left;
-    .anticon-plus {
-      font-size: 20px;
-      color: #26C281;
-      padding: 5px;
-      margin-right: 10px;
-    }
-  }
-  .ant-pagination {
-    float: right;
-    margin: 10px;
-  }
-
-  .model-menu-action-list {
-    .page-card {
-      line-height: 55px;
-    }
+  .am-tab-bar-tab-title {
+    display: none;
   }
 }
 .normal-navbar-edit-box::after {
@@ -112,22 +103,3 @@
 .top-menu-popover {
   padding-top: 0!important;
 }
-.normal-navbar-submenu {
-  .ant-menu-item-group {
-    float: left;
-  }
-  .ant-menu-item {
-    height: 32px;
-    line-height: 32px;
-    span {
-      display: inline-block;
-      width: 100%;
-      height: 100%;
-      padding: 0 16px 0 28px;
-    }
-    padding: 0;
-  }
-  .ant-menu .ant-menu-item-selected {
-    background-color: #ffffff;
-  }
-}
\ No newline at end of file

--
Gitblit v1.8.0